Cardiac aldosterone and corticosterone regulated genes in mice with cardiomyocytes targeted mineralocorticoid receptor overexpression (MR-Cardio mice) and their controls (Ctrl mice)

Description: Inappropriate mineralocorticoid receptor (MR) activation is involved in cardiac diseases. MR binds aldosterone, but also glucocorticoids; the identity of the ligand responsible for the deleterious effects of cardiac MR activation is still unclear. Mice overexpressing MR in cardiomyocytes (MR-Cardio) and their controls (Ctrl) were treated for 7 days with aldosterone or corticosterone and a whole genome microarray analysis was performed.Overall design: Six-group experiment: Control mice (Ctrl), transgenic mice (MR-Cardio), Ctrl mice + aldosterone treatment, MR-Cardio mice + aldosterone treatment, Ctrl mice + corticosterone treatment, MR-Cardio mice + corticosterone treatment. Five comparisons: Ctrl vs MR-Cardio, Ctrl vs Ctrl-Aldo, Ctrl vs Ctrl-Cortico, MR-Cardio vs MR-Cardio-Aldo, MR-Cardio vs MR-Cardio-Cortico
